Commit 5ca5ba61 by caoyanzhi

添加生日类型

parent b03544c2
......@@ -83,6 +83,8 @@ export default {
memberName: '',
memberGender: '',
memberBirthday: '',
birthType: '',
birthTypeStr: '',
phoneNumber: '',
unsubscribe: '',
cliqueCardNo: '',
......@@ -110,6 +112,7 @@ export default {
memberName: '',
memberGender: '',
memberBirthday: '',
birthType: '',
phoneNumber: '',
nationCode: '',
remark: ''
......@@ -273,6 +276,7 @@ export default {
memberId: this.memberId,
updateStatus: this.updateStatus,
memberBirthday: fomatBirthday(this.posForm.memberBirthday),
birthType: this.posForm.birthType === '' ? 1 : this.posForm.birthType,
remark: this.posForm.remark
}
}
......@@ -332,6 +336,7 @@ export default {
break;
case 3:
this.posForm.memberBirthday = this.posMemberInfo.memberBirthday;
this.posForm.birthType = this.posMemberInfo.birthType;
this.updateTitle = '出生日期';
break;
case 4:
......@@ -440,6 +445,7 @@ export default {
memberName: temp.memberName,
memberGender: temp.memberGender,
memberBirthday: temp.memberBirthday,
birthType: temp.birthType,
phoneNumber: temp.phoneNumber,
unsubscribe: temp.unsubscribe,
storedValue: temp.storedValue,
......@@ -448,6 +454,17 @@ export default {
cliqueGradeName: temp.cliqueGradeName,
cliqueMemberIntegral: temp.cliqueMemberIntegral
}
switch (this.posMemberInfo.birthType) {
case 1:
this.posMemberInfo.birthTypeStr = '(阳历)';
break;
case 0:
this.posMemberInfo.birthTypeStr = '(农历)';
break;
default:
this.posMemberInfo.birthTypeStr = '';
break;
}
}else {
checkFalse(res.data.message);
}
......
......@@ -65,8 +65,14 @@
<i class="el-icon-edit pointer" @click="editGrade(1)"></i></span></span></div>
<div class="pos-item"><span class="pos-leftitem" >性别 <span class="pos-color"> {{ posMemberInfo.memberGender | formatGender }}
<i class="el-icon-edit pointer" @click="editGrade(2)"></i></span></span></div>
<div class="pos-item"><span class="pos-leftitem">出生日期 <span class="pos-color"> {{ posMemberInfo.memberBirthday | formatYMD }}
<i class="el-icon-edit pointer" @click="editGrade(3)"></i></span></span></div>
<div class="pos-item">
<span class="pos-leftitem">
出生日期 {{posMemberInfo.birthTypeStr}}
<span class="pos-color"> {{ posMemberInfo.memberBirthday | formatYMD }}
<i class="el-icon-edit pointer" @click="editGrade(3)"></i>
</span>
</span>
</div>
<div class="pos-item"><span class="pos-leftitem">手机号码 <span class="pos-color"> {{ posMemberInfo.phoneNumber }}
<i class="el-icon-edit pointer" @click="editGrade(4)"></i></span></span></div>
<div class="pos-item"><span class="pos-leftitem">退订状态 <span class="pos-color"> {{ posMemberInfo.unsubscribe == 1 ? '退订' : '未退订' }} </span></span></div>
......@@ -213,7 +219,18 @@
</el-select>
</el-form-item>
<el-form-item label="出生日期" prop="memberBirthday" v-show="updateStatus == 3">
<el-date-picker :clearable="false" value-format="timestamp" style="width: 100%;" v-model="posForm.memberBirthday" type="date" placeholder="出生日期"></el-date-picker>
<el-row>
<el-col :span="6">
<el-select style="width: 100%" v-model="posForm.birthType" placeholder="阳历">
<el-option key="农历" :value="0" label="农历"></el-option>
<el-option key="阳历" :value="1" label="阳历"></el-option>
</el-select>
</el-col>
<el-col :span="1">&nbsp;</el-col>
<el-col :span="17">
<el-date-picker :clearable="false" value-format="timestamp" style="width: 100%;" v-model="posForm.memberBirthday" type="date" placeholder="出生日期"></el-date-picker>
</el-col>
</el-row>
</el-form-item>
<el-form-item ref="phoneNumber" label="手机号码" prop="phoneNumber" v-show="updateStatus == 4">
<el-row>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ment